Roasted Stuffed Dates

Roasted Stuffed Dates: A Delicious and Easy Recipe for Your Next Gathering


  • Author: Goldie Clark
  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: 20 stuffed dates 1x
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Description

A delicious and easy recipe for your next gathering.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 20 Medjool dates
  • 1 cup cream cheese
  • 1/2 cup chopped walnuts
  • 1/4 cup honey
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. Carefully slice each date lengthwise and remove the pit.
  3. In a bowl, mix the cream cheese, chopped walnuts, honey, vanilla extract, and cinnamon until well combined.
  4. Stuff each date with the cream cheese mixture.
  5. Place the stuffed dates on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
  6. Bake in the preheated oven for 10-15 minutes, or until the dates are warm and slightly caramelized.
  7. Remove from the oven and let cool slightly before serving.

Notes

  • Feel free to substitute walnuts with pecans or almonds.
  • For a vegan option, use a plant-based cream cheese alternative.
  • These can be made ahead of time and reheated before serving.
